"Dykes, Disabilities & Stuff" focused on representation for and inclusion of disabled Lesbians. To this end, it featured reader submissions, letters, artwork and poetry. It also featured articles about various aspects of Lesbian culture; reviews of Lesbian books; and news pertaining to disabled and Lesbian concerns. Also included were advertisements for Lesbian events, publications and businesses.
Volume 3, #1 features an "Anniversary Index" listing and describing past issues.

"Dykes, Disability & Stuff" was an irregularly published magazine focused on Lesbians and disabilities. Founded in the summer of 1988 and originally published by Catherine (Lohr) Odette and Sara Karon, it was first produced out of Boston, Massachusetts, but later moved production to Madison, Wisconsin. The magazine was issued in six different formats to accommodate readers with various disabilities. These included standard print, large print, Braille and cassette recording. After losing funding from its Boston sponsor following its 1991 move to Wisconsin, the magazine struggled financially, ultimately ceasing production in the Fall of 2001.Publication Details
